Accepting second best is good for her career, but first-grade teacher, Retta Curt, delays signing up for the disappointment. Given two weeks to reconsider her contract, she retreats to Gram’s cottage on Moon Lake, the last place she felt contentment. But the cottage is derelict; Cousin Julie, distant; childhood beaux, Dean, bitter; and Sweet Picks, the family ice cream stand, in danger of folding. Magruder, a surly newcomer, is buying and then neglecting properties until nothing remains of the idyllic lakeside community she remembers. When vandals target Sweet Picks, Retta’s dreams to recapture her happy childhood collapse, and the return to Moon Lake becomes a decision worse than accepting her teaching contract. Star-crossed, can she save the family business and rediscover happiness, or is Retta destined for a second-best future?

REVIEW
Double Dipped is a quick cozy read, but I do wish it was more fleshed out instead of being a novella, I felt something was missing with it being a quick read.
Retta isn’t sure if she wants to return to teaching after summer so gives her employer two weeks to make a decision in which time she packs up her car and head to Moon Lake and her late grandmother’s home, only to find it in disrepair and for sale. She takes the chance and buys it but soon discovers that there is a lot going on in the sleepy little town. Magruder for intents and purpose is the big baddie in this tale, sweeping into the town and buying up properties left right and centre, and Retta thinks he is the one who may be behind the recent spat of vandalism to her cousin Julie’s ice cream shack Sweet Picks.
Turns out looks can be deceiving and when the truth finally comes out it leaves Retta, Julie and other of the Moon Lake shocked.
This was a good cozy read and I did enjoy it though I would have loved more fleshing out of the story it felt too much to pack into a novella, and I also didn’t understand Retta interaction when she first meet her cousin Julie – If I hadn’t see family in such a long time I would have been right in for the hugs but then again it would have lessened the thing that is going with Julie.
4 stars
About Terry Korth Fischer

Terry Korth Fischer writes short stories, memoirs, and mysteries. Her debut mystery, Gone Astray, introduced Detective Rory Naysmith, a seasoned city cop relocated to small-town Winterset, Nebraska. The Rory Naysmith Mysteries continued with Gone Before, January 2022. Transplanted from the Midwest, Terry lives in Houston, Texas, with her husband and two guard cats. When not writing, she loves reading, gardening, and basking in sunshine. Yet, her heart often wanders to the country’s heartland, where she spent a memorable—ordinary but charmed—childhood.
